George Cecil Evans 1902–1982 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: abt 1902
Birth Location: Birmingham, Worcester, England
Death Date: 1982
Death Location: London, Middlesex County, Ontario, Canada
Father: Ernest Evans
Mother: Julia Graves
Spouse(s): Sadie Mack
Children(s):
The story of George Cecil Evans began in 1902 in Birmingham, Worcester, England. In 1911, George Cecil Evans resided in South Manchester, Lancashire, England. George Cecil Evans married Sadie Mack. George Cecil Evans passed away in 1982 in London, Middlesex County, Ontario, Canada.
